IEEE 802.3-2005 CSMA/CD标准:FPGA EMAC开发的关键参考资料

5星 · 超过95%的资源 需积分: 50 3 下载量 148 浏览量 更新于2024-07-21 收藏 12.84MB PDF 举报
IEEE 802.3-2005标准,全称为"信息技术——电信和信息系统之间的通信——本地和城域网络——特定要求——第三部分:带有冲突检测的载波感知多路访问(CSMA/CD)接入方法及物理层规范",是IEEE针对局域网(LAN)和城域网(MAN)设计的重要通信标准。这个标准在2005年进行了修订,包含了2002版的所有批准修正案,旨在提供一致、高效和可靠的数据传输协议。 该标准的核心内容关注于CSMA/CD(Carrier Sense Multiple Access with Collision Detection)技术,这是一种早期广泛应用于以太网中的介质访问控制(MAC)协议。CSMA/CD通过监听网络媒介上的信号强度来决定是否发送数据,如果检测到信号活跃则暂时等待,避免数据包冲突。这种机制保证了在同一网络段内的设备能有序地共享带宽,提高网络效率。 物理层规范方面,IEEE 802.3-2005标准定义了电气接口、信号传输速率、编码方式、以及物理介质的特性要求,例如支持不同的传输速率(如10Mbps、100Mbps、1Gbps等),以及对于双绞线、光纤等不同媒介的支持。它还规定了错误检测和纠正机制,确保数据的准确性。 作为FPGA EMAC(Embedded Multi-Mode Attachment Controller)开发的必备参考资料,IEEE 802.3-2005标准对于理解以太网的设计原理、实现MAC子层功能、以及确保设备间的兼容性至关重要。对于TCP/IP开发人员来说,它也是网络通信底层协议的基础,帮助开发者构建高效、稳定且可扩展的网络架构。 此外,该标准还强调了版权和标准化过程,由IEEE LAN/MAN Standards Committee制定,并经IEEE-SA Standards Board批准。通过遵循这些标准,制造商可以确保其产品符合业界最佳实践,同时为用户提供无缝的网络体验。 IEEE 802.3-2005标准是IT行业中关于局域网通信不可或缺的技术指南,无论是在理论研究、硬件设计还是实际项目开发中,都扮演着关键的角色。了解和掌握这一标准,对于提高网络性能和确保互操作性具有重要意义。